Green tea, derived from the leaves of the Camellia sinensis plant, is a popular beverage appreciated for its flavor and wellness benefits. The preparation method, specifically the temperature of the water used for brewing, fundamentally alters the chemical composition of the final drink. This difference in temperature creates a distinct trade-off in the extraction of beneficial compounds, the concentration of stimulants, and the resulting taste experience. Understanding the science behind hot and cold brewing is necessary for maximizing health benefits and tailoring the cup to personal preferences.
Temperature’s Role in Antioxidant Extraction and Stability
Green tea’s primary health benefits are attributed to catechins, particularly Epigallocatechin Gallate (EGCG). High-temperature brewing is a highly efficient method for extracting these compounds quickly from the tea leaves. Using water heated to the recommended range of 75°C to 85°C rapidly pulls a high concentration of EGCG into the solution.
However, the delicate molecular structure of EGCG is not completely stable under high heat conditions. Prolonged exposure to elevated temperatures can accelerate the degradation and isomerization of catechins, reducing the antioxidant content. This means a hot cup provides an immediate, high-dose yield, but the compounds begin to break down relatively quickly after brewing.
Cold brewing extracts the catechins much more slowly. While the initial concentration of EGCG may be lower compared to a properly executed hot steep, the stability of these antioxidants in the cold solution is significantly higher. Storing the cold-brewed tea at a refrigerated temperature of about 2°C helps to preserve the EGCG from oxidation and degradation. Therefore, cold brewing favors stability and a slow, steady extraction, whereas hot brewing is designed for rapid, maximum yield.
Caffeine Levels and Absorption Differences
The temperature of the water is the single greatest factor influencing how much caffeine is released from the tea leaves. Caffeine is highly water-soluble, and its solubility increases dramatically as the temperature of the water rises. A hot brew, utilizing temperatures between 75°C and 85°C, results in a rapid and high extraction of caffeine, providing a quick stimulating effect.
Conversely, cold brewing, which occurs at much lower temperatures, extracts significantly less caffeine from the same amount of tea leaves. Studies suggest that cold-brewed tea typically contains about one-third to one-half the caffeine of a comparable hot-brewed cup. This lower concentration of the stimulant results in a smoother, less intense sensation for the consumer.
The physiological absorption rate of caffeine is not significantly affected by the liquid’s initial temperature. Once consumed, the beverage rapidly approaches the body’s internal temperature of approximately 37°C in the stomach and small intestine. Therefore, the difference in the perceived effect between hot and cold green tea is primarily due to the total amount of caffeine extracted, rather than the temperature at which the liquid is ultimately absorbed.
Flavor Profile and Sensory Experience
The different extraction kinetics of hot and cold water create vastly divergent flavor profiles in the final brew. Hot water quickly dissolves a wide range of compounds, including amino acids for flavor, but it also rapidly extracts polyphenols known as tannins. These tannins are responsible for the bitter, dry, and astringent mouthfeel often associated with over-steeped green tea.
The slow, temperature-controlled process of cold brewing minimizes the release of these bitter tannins. The result is a naturally sweeter, smoother, and less astringent taste that highlights the subtle, grassy, or floral notes of the green tea leaf. Many drinkers find that cold-brewed green tea requires little to no added sweetener due to this inherently mellow flavor.
The choice of preparation also affects the immediate sensory experience and convenience. Hot brewing provides instant gratification, yielding a completed beverage in just a few minutes. Cold brewing, while producing a smoother flavor, demands patience, requiring an extended steeping period of 6 to 12 hours in the refrigerator.
Maximizing Benefits with Proper Brewing Techniques
To gain the highest concentration of antioxidants and a full flavor from hot green tea, it is important to avoid using boiling water. The optimal temperature range for hot brewing green tea is typically between 77°C and 85°C (170°F–185°F) for a steeping time of two to three minutes. This controlled method maximizes EGCG extraction while limiting the release of bitter compounds.
For cold brewing, steep the tea leaves in filtered water and refrigerate the mixture. An ideal steeping duration is generally between 8 and 12 hours, allowing for a thorough extraction of flavor and stable antioxidants without bitterness. Using a higher ratio of leaves to water can also compensate for the slower extraction rate of the cold method.
Ultimately, the best way to enjoy green tea depends on one’s specific priorities. If an immediate, high concentration of caffeine and antioxidants is desired, hot brewing is the superior method. However, for a smoother, less bitter taste and a beverage with highly stable antioxidants and lower caffeine, the slow process of cold brewing is the ideal choice.
